Common questions about endodontists

What does an endodontist do?

An endodontist specializes in treating the inside of the tooth — the pulp and root canals. They complete two or more years of advanced training beyond dental school and handle root canal treatment, root canal retreatment, cracked teeth, and dental trauma, often using microscopes and 3D imaging for precision.

When do I need an endodontist instead of my regular dentist?

Your general dentist will usually refer you when a tooth needs a complex root canal — curved or narrow canals, a retreatment of a previous root canal, or persistent pain that’s hard to diagnose. Severe, lingering tooth pain, sensitivity to hot and cold, or swelling near a tooth are all signs the pulp may be infected and worth an endodontic evaluation.
